Carley Mullally (BFA 2015) found purpose in art during the pandemic. Their work is currently being exhibited at the SMU Art Gallery as part of a group exhibition called Crafts_Ship. The show features work by three artists from the South Shore, including Mullally, exploring the life of seafarers through various mediums.

Dr. Jayne Wark, a Professor in the Division of Art History and Contemporary Culture, has accumulated hundreds and hundreds of books in her 33-year career as a scholar.  Now in her last year at NSCAD, she is giving her book collection away to students.
